Carl Eve is an award-winning crime reporter for Plymouth Live and has been since 2006. Before that he worked at BBC's Current Affairs in White City and TV Centre as a researcher and at the Basildon Echo as a crime reporter. He's also worked as a reporter at Southend Echo, Castle Point Echo and Thurrock Gazette
